Does 1'2c 12k on my gold necklace mean it's plated?

Yes, "1/20th 12K" or "1/20 12K" on a gold necklace indicates that the necklace is gold filled. This means that 1/20th of the weight of the necklace is made up of 12K gold. It is not solid gold, but rather a layer of gold bonded to a base metal.


What does the stamp 14K GE mean on a gold necklace?

14 KT Gold Electroplate, not solid gold thus less value and less cost

What does the marking 14k gcj mean on a necklace?

It means REAL 14K Gold, 58.3% Solid Gold. GCJ is the manufacturer
